Al-Qadsiah’s Decision to Let Aubameyang Go
Last year, the Gabon international moved from Marseille to Al-Qadsiah, yet his time in the Middle East ended after only 12 months. Even with his standout performance of 17 goals in that initial campaign, the Saudi outfit has chosen to move on, prioritizing the addition of fresher faces to bolster their offensive lineup.
Latest Negotiations and Club Interests
As per insights from a trusted source like Fabrizio Romano, Marseille has already engaged in early discussions with the veteran player this week and is currently ironing out the monetary details of a proposed two-year agreement for the forward. With Al-Qadsiah’s approval in place for his departure this summer, the path seems clear for potential moves forward.
Reasons Behind Marseille’s Pursuit
The manager at Marseille, Roberto De Zerbi, appears enthusiastic about bringing in the former star from Arsenal and Chelsea to strengthen their forward options. This Italian coach appreciates the depth of knowledge and reliable scoring ability that the striker brings, especially to a team that depends largely on up-and-coming attackers for its firepower.
